JavaScripting

The definitive source of the best
JavaScript libraries, frameworks, and plugins.


  • Dayjs

    ⏰ Day.js 2KB immutable date library alternative to Moment.js with the same modern API

    94%
  • Moment

    Parse, validate, manipulate, and display dates in javascript.

    94%
  • Babel

    Babel is a compiler for writing next generation JavaScript.

    93%
  • Mathjs

    An extensive math library for JavaScript and Node.js

    85%
  • Inversify Js

    A powerful and lightweight inversion of control container for JavaScript & Node.js apps powered by TypeScript.

    83%
  • Respond

    A fast & lightweight polyfill for min/max-width CSS3 Media Queries (for IE 6-8, and more)

    76%
  • Numeral

    A javascript library for formatting and manipulating numbers.

    76%
  • Bignumber.js

    A JavaScript library for arbitrary-precision decimal and non-decimal arithmetic

    75%
  • HTML5shiv

    This script is the defacto way to enable use of HTML5 sectioning elements in legacy Internet Explorer.

    75%
  • Decimal.js

    An arbitrary-precision Decimal type for JavaScript

    71%
  • ES5 Shims

    ECMAScript 5 compatibility shims for legacy JavaScript engines

    70%
  • Big.js

    A small, fast JavaScript library for arbitrary-precision decimal arithmetic.

    66%
  • Tiny Color

    Fast, small color manipulation and conversion for JavaScript

    66%
  • Underscore String

    String manipulation extensions for Underscore.js javascript library.

    63%
  • Xregexp

    Extended JavaScript regular expressions

    62%
  • Sugar

    A Javascript library for working with native objects.

    61%
  • Es6 Shim

    ECMAScript 6 (Harmony) compatibility shims for legacy JavaScript engines

    60%